Mr. Neil Krishnaswamy is a Principal at Burns Wealth Management, Inc.
Prior to joining Burns Wealth Management in 2013, he was Principal at Investors Asset Management, Inc since 2011.
Prior to entering financial services, he worked in the hard disk drive industry for 9 years, holding positions in electronics and software development.
Mr. Krishnaswamy earned BS degree in Electrical Engineering and Minor in Spanish from Purdue University.

Investors Asset Management, Inc. Investment ManagersFinance The investment philosophy at IAM is 'Selective Investment'. It is long-term, value based and inclusive of social investment selectivity. Portfolio managers focus on companies of excellence in fundamental and social characteristics. Selective Investment is based on excellence of qualities in companies researched in the following areas: financial management and performance, definition and execution of strategy, return to shareholders, quality and societal usefulness of product, treatment of employees, representation of women and minorities, environmental policies and practices, benefits returned to communities and management ethics and corporate culture.
